Computer problem
1994 Buick Lesabre 6 cyl Front Wheel Drive Automatic 62000 miles
We had a 1994 buick that kept shutting off, we took it to the mechanic and he said it was a computer problem. We had the computer switched out and it ran good for a couple months now it is doing the same thing. It will run for awhile then just shut off while your driving or it wont even stay started long enough to go anywhere. Is it still a computer problem? Can you reset the computer? |

Has the check engine light come on? HAve you checked fuel pump pressure?
As far as resetting the computer, disconnect the battery for about 15 minutes. If there are codes stored, it should reset them.
Let me know what you find. |

It could be a few things. Have you had the computer scanned? IF the check engine light is on, chances are there is a trouble code there that will help identify where the problem is coming from.
Let me know. ALso, most nationally recognized parts stores will do it for free.
